11 hurt after taxi crashes down embankment on South Coast

Eleven people have been treated by paramedics - after the mini-bus taxi they were travelling in veered off the D916 and crashed down an embankment, on the South Coast.

Netcare911 says its believed the driver of the taxi reportedly lost control of the vehicle, causing it to veer off the road in KwaGamalakhe.

Eleven people, including the driver, were treated for minor to moderate injuries. 

They were taken to a nearby hospital once treated.
